Demetra George is a professional astrologer who received her Masters degree in Classics from the University of Oregon. She has been active in astrology since 1971 and in 2002 she received the renowned Regulus Award in Theory and Understanding. Specializing in archetypal mythology and ancient techniques, she is the author of Asteroid Goddesses, Astrology for Yourself, Mysteries of the Dark Moon, Finding Our Way through the Dark, Astrology and the Authentic Self (Nov. 2008), and Elements of Hellenistic Astrology (forthcoming). Demetra lectures internationally and leads educational pilgrimages to the sacred sites of Greece and India with Ancient Oracle Tours. She is currently translating a corpus of Hermetic medical astrological texts from ancient Greek. She is the director of Thema: Foundations in Astrology which offers individually tailored personal instruction in the fundamentals of interpretation, chart delineation, Hellenistic astrology, mythic asteroids, and ancient Greek for astrologers. She is an associate of Project Hindsight and has taught the history of astrology at Kepler College and the University of Oregon. She lives in Eugene, Oregon.
